Madhya Pradesh: CM Dr Mohan Yadav’s Inspiring Address at Shikhar Khel Alankaran Celebrates 38th National Games Medal Winners

Vishwas Sarang Commends Sports-Driven Societal Progress, Calls for Madhya Pradesh to Aim for Number One Spot
Indian Masterminds Stories

Bhopal: Chief Minister Dr. Mohan Yadav delivered a powerful and motivating speech at the Madhya Pradesh Shikhar Khel Alankaran event and felicitation ceremony for the medal winners of the 38th National Games 2025. The event was held at Ravindra Bhawan, Bhopal, where Dr. Yadav emphasized the true spirit of sportsmanship, drawing inspiration from the lives of Lord Rama and Lord Krishna.

Sportsmanship Rooted in Indian Mythology: Lessons from Lord Rama and Lord Krishna

Dr Yadav highlighted how sportsmanship is deeply embedded in the transformative episodes of Lord Rama and Shri Krishna’s lives. He narrated how Maharishi Vishwamitra sought young Lord Rama’s courage to defeat demons terrorizing the forests, exemplifying the essence of taking on challenges with determination. The Chief Minister remarked that Lord Rama’s victory over demons and his symbolic act of breaking Lord Shiva’s bow represent the spirit of a true player—one who accepts challenges and triumphs.

He further discussed how sports impart freedom, courage, and resilience. Drawing from Lord Krishna’s childhood, born in imprisonment and repeatedly targeted by the tyrant Kansa, Dr. Yadav explained how Krishna’s defiance and clever strategies to protect his people showcased the qualities of a sportsman. Krishna’s effort to reclaim milk and ghee meant for Kansa symbolized persistence, teamwork, and the refusal to surrender—qualities every player must embrace.

A player is one who accepts the challenge, competes, wins, and achieves the highest standards of life,” Dr. Yadav stated, extending his heartfelt congratulations to all the medal-winning athletes.

Sports as a Catalyst for Societal Progress: Insights by Vishwas Kailash Sarang

Sports and Youth Welfare Minister Vishwas Kailash Sarang praised the transformative power of sports in steering society toward discipline, unity, and progress. He lauded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s initiatives to accelerate development and welfare across the country, emphasizing the special campaigns linking India’s future with sports excellence by 2047.

Sarang highlighted the impressive rise of Madhya Pradesh in the National Games, climbing from 21st to 3rd position, attributing this success to the dedication of athletes and strong leadership under Dr. Mohan Yadav—himself an avid sportsman. The minister called upon players to pledge that Madhya Pradesh would soon rise to number one.

He further announced the Chief Minister’s commitment to constructing stadiums in every assembly constituency to nurture sporting talent and infrastructure across the state.

Madhya Pradesh’s Journey to Sporting Excellence

The 38th National Games saw Madhya Pradesh securing a strong third position—a testament to the hard work and perseverance of its athletes. The felicitation ceremony not only celebrated these achievements but also inspired the sports community to aim higher.

Dr. Yadav’s personal connection with sports adds depth to his vision for Madhya Pradesh’s sporting future, reflecting a governance model that supports athletes and promotes a culture of excellence and healthy competition.
